/ / / Porsche 924 2L Oil Pump 046115109A FOR PARTS Yard SF31

Porsche Porsche 924 2L Oil Pump 046115109A FOR PARTS 924 Oil Pump 046115109A FOR PARTS Yard SF31

£28.00 £30.00

Key Characteristics

Make: Porsche

Product Details

Porsche 924 2L Oil Pump 046115109A FOR PARTS

Listed FOR PARTS

NOTE... Pump is UNTESTED

              Nothing Looks Damaged